What is Petrovietnam Drilling & Well Service Receivables Turnover?

Petrovietnam Drilling & Well Service STC:PVD -4.46% 94 Receivables Turnover is 0.75 as of Mar. 2026. GuruFocus rates STC:PVD with a GF Score™ of 94/100 and a GF Value™ of ₫28,837.91 (Possible Value Trap). The stock has 3 warning signs investors should review. Among 891 Oil & Gas companies, Petrovietnam Drilling & Well Service ranks worse than 84.74% on this metric.

The Receivables Turnover ratio measures the number of times a company collects its average accounts receivable balance. It is calculated as Revenue divided by average Accounts Receivable. An efficient company has a higher accounts receivable turnover ratio while an inefficient company has a lower ratio. Petrovietnam Drilling & Well Service's Revenue for the three months ended in Mar. 2026 was ₫3,401,071 Mil. Petrovietnam Drilling & Well Service's average Accounts Receivable for the three months ended in Mar. 2026 was ₫4,558,115 Mil. Hence, Petrovietnam Drilling & Well Service's Receivables Turnover for the three months ended in Mar. 2026 was 0.75.


Petrovietnam Drilling & Well Service  (STC:PVD) Receivables Turnover Explanation

An efficient company has a higher accounts receivable turnover ratio while an inefficient company has a lower ratio. This metric is commonly used to compare companies within the same industry to check whether they are on par with their competitors.

Petrovietnam Drilling & Well Service Receivables Turnover Calculation

Receivables Turnover measures the number of times a company collects its average accounts receivable balance.

Petrovietnam Drilling & Well Service's Receivables Turnover for the fiscal year that ended in Dec. 2025 is calculated as

Receivables Turnover (A: Dec. 2025 )
=Revenue / Average Accounts Receivable
=Revenue (A: Dec. 2025 ) / ((Accounts Receivable (A: Dec. 2024 ) + Accounts Receivable (A: Dec. 2025 )) / count )
=10896989.276 / ((2723586.218 + 4313704.305) / 2 )
=10896989.276 / 3518645.2615
=3.10

Petrovietnam Drilling & Well Service's Receivables Turnover for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 is calculated as

Receivables Turnover (Q: Mar. 2026 )
=Revenue / Average Accounts Receivable
=Revenue (Q: Mar. 2026 ) / ((Accounts Receivable (Q: Dec. 2025 ) + Accounts Receivable (Q: Mar. 2026 )) / count )
=3401070.967 / ((4313704.305 + 4802524.877) / 2 )
=3401070.967 / 4558114.591
=0.75

Petrovietnam Drilling & Well Service Business Description

Industry EnergyOil & Gas
Address 4th Floor, Sailing Tower, 111A Pasteur Street, Ben Nghe Ward, District 1, Ho Chi Minh, VNM
Petrovietnam Drilling & Well Service Corp is a provider of drilling rigs and technical services for the exploration and exploitation of oil and gas industry locally and internationally. The company operates through three segments namely Drilling services, Trading, and Other services. Its Drilling services segment offers drilling rigs and drilling services. The Trading segment produces material and equipment for drilling-related activities. Its Other services segment is involved in administering well services, wireline logging, oil spill control service, drilling manpower supply service, investment-management project consulting service, management consulting service and other related services. Geographically it operates in Vietnam, Malaysia, Myanmar, Algeria.
